当前位置: 首页 > news >正文

vue3+vite 实现.env全局配置

首先创建.env文件

VUE_APP_BASE_API='http://127.0.0.1/dev-api'

然后引入依赖:

pnpm install dotenv --save-dev

引入完成后,在vite.config.js配置文件内加入以下内容:

const env = dotenv.config({ path: './.env' }).parsed

define: {

    // 将环境变量注入到全局变量中

    'process.env': env

  },

const env = dotenv.config({ path: './.env' }).parsedexport default defineConfig({plugins: [vue()],define: {// 将环境变量注入到全局变量中'process.env': env}
})

这样就配置完成了,然后在js内process.env.VUE_APP_BASE_API就可以直接获取到数据了。

http://www.dtcms.com/a/140558.html

相关文章:

  • 【jenkins】首次配置jenkins
  • Java Web 之 Servlet 100问
  • SonarQube 集成教程
  • 并发设计模式实战系列(2):领导者/追随者模式
  • SS25001-多路复用开关板
  • 010数论——算法备赛
  • 航电系统通信与数据链技术分析
  • 15 nginx 中默认的 proxy_buffering 导致基于 http 的流式响应存在 buffer, 以 4kb 一批次返回
  • 编程常见错误归类
  • 第五届能源工程、新能源材料与器件国际学术会议(NEMD 2025)
  • 使用VHD虚拟磁盘安装双系统,避免磁盘分区
  • 每天学一个 Linux 命令(23):file
  • 电能质量治理解决方案:构建高效、安全的电力系统
  • 前端:uniapp中uni.pageScrollTo方法与元素的overflow-y:auto之间的关联
  • 《软件设计师》复习笔记(11.2)——开发方法、产品线、软件复用、逆向
  • docker部署springboot(eureka server)项目
  • 网安加·百家讲坛 | 刘志诚:AI安全风险与未来展望
  • 8.观察者模式:思考与解读
  • 3D机器视觉激光器在智能制造领域的主要应用
  • 【LeetCode】大厂面试算法真题回忆(61)--组装新的数组
  • 电子电器架构 --- OEM企标中规定ECU启动时间的目的
  • 基于C++(MFC)的细胞识别程序
  • 焊接机器人的设计
  • CVE-2023-46604漏洞复现与深度分析
  • jQuery — DOM与CSS操作
  • 【MySQL】MySQL表的增删改查(CRUD) —— 上篇
  • 轻松实现文字转语音 - Coqui TTS部署实践
  • 鸿蒙NEXT开发键值型数据工具类(ArkTs)
  • 直线轴承在自动化机械设备中的应用
  • PHP连接MYSQL数据库